Job Duties
- Interview, select, train, schedule, coach and support associates
- Oversee preparation and production of menus, development and execution of recipes
- Manage kitchen operations and assigned staff
- Ensure staff prepares menu items following recipes and yield guides, in accordance with department standards
- Develop new menu items, test and create recipes
- Train, develop and evaluate personnel with regard to proper use of standard kitchen equipment and tools, techniques and skills
- Supervise kitchen personnel to ensure that methods of cooking, garnishes and portion sizes are as prescribed
- Manage budget, monitor costs and operating needs in keeping with overall containment of unnecessary expenditures
- Direct and develop skills of the team to the achievement of department and area goals
- Evaluate all direct reports and conduct introductory period and annual performance reviews
- Maintain an open door policy and address all team member issues and/or concerns in a timely manner
- Conduct divisional/departmental staff meetings on a monthly basis
- Follow sustainability guidelines and practices related to HHM’s EarthView program
- Practice safe work habits, wear protective safety equipment and follow MSDS and OSHA standards
- Perform other duties as requested by management
